Join Tribeca Festival Creator Vishaal Reddy, Award-Winning Director Michelle Cutolo, the series producers, and members of the cast for the Premiere of the upcoming new series "Insomnia'.
Taking cues from Master of None, Louie, Fleabag, and High Maintenance, the series follows a South Asian bisexual writer suffering from insomnia who secretly moonlights as an escort to support his sick aunt.
Insomnia is a half hour, single-camera dramedy series that follows the darkly, absurd, late night adventures of Nikhil Sharma (Vishaal Reddy, The Punisher, Bull), a struggling, Indian-American writer that can’t seem to get his life together, his best friend, Savan (Cheech Manohar, Mean Girls on Broadway), a type-A dental student who's charm constantly bails Nikhil out of trouble, Leela (Kuhoo Verma, The Big Sick), a scrappy Hillary Clinton wannabe who struggles to be taken seriously in a male dominant field, and Nikhil's aunt, Meera (Nandita Shenoy), a crafty polished woman, who's multiple sclerosis is causing her life to deteriorate. This is Nikhil's journey to find love, happiness, and his true identity. This is a story about growing up. And Failing. A lot.
The series also stars Nikki Renee Daniels (Hamilton, Book of Mormon), Aneesh Sheth (Difficult People, High Maintenance, New Amsterdam), Alison Barton (Master of None), James Seol (Living With Yourself), Daniel Burns, Jason Veasey (The Lion King on Broadway)
This Premiere is part of a double feature that will also screen the film "Lust, Life, Love", which stars Stephanie Sellars and features the likes of Bill Irwin, Jake Choi, and Makeda Declet.
